I guess, Elwood, you don't know nothing about the "Bus Driver?" Heyward "Red" Hutson was born on May 14, 1883 in Blacksville, S.C. Mr. Hutson moved to Orlando Florida and work as a Bus Driver. In 1918, Mr. Hutson started making pier baits, one he called the "Bus Driver" which he gave away on his bus routes. The following was found on a card with one of his lures which said... "The Bus Driver's Pal"... "You don't have to spit on it"... "Made by R.H. Hutson... "that Fishing Fool from Alligator Creek." Elwood, now you know the rest of the story!
